The organ stands at the head of the south gallery of this Georgian church; the console is detached,
with tracker key actions and electric drawstop actions. The front pipes are of tin.
The original casework, made early in the 20th century, has been redesigned and re-made. It is modelled
on an eighteenth-century Snetzler design at Sculthorpe, Norfolk. The pipe shades have been altered
and the curved pipe-blocks are new; the decorated panels were carved by Derek Riley.
The manual compass is 58 notes; the pedal 30 notes
The electric blower supplies the wind through double-rise reservoirs
